Playback

1Press the STANDBY button to turn the unit on.

The indicator is red in the standby mode. It turns blue when the unit is turned on.

standby indicator

2Press the OPEN/CLOSE button (L) to open the tray.

3Insert the disc label side up.

<In the case of double-sided discs, the side to be played should be face down.

<Make sure the disc is centered in the tray in order to avoid any malfunction or jamming of the tray or damage to the disc.

4Press the OPEN/CLOSE button (L) again to close the tray.

The tray will close. Take care that you don’t catch your fingers in the tray.

The unit reads the disc (this may take a little time).

5Press the PLAY button to start playback.

Pausing playback

Press the PAUSE button to pause playback.

Press PLAY or PAUSE to restart playback.

Stopping playback

Press the STOP button to stop playback.

Opening and closing the tray

Pressing OPEN/CLOSE opens the tray if it is closed, and closes it if it is open. When the tray is opened during playback, it may take a few seconds before the disc is “unloaded” and the tray opens.

<When playback is stopped, pressing the L/H button of the main unit opens and closes the disc tray.
